MMA legend Wanderlei Silva has admitted he is hoping for a return to the Octagon in February or March.
The Brazilian fighter is currently recovering from surgery to his right knee, but attended the UFC 118 event this past weekend.
“I feel good,” Silva told MMA Fighting during UFC 118 weekend. “I had surgery and in the last year I’ve repaired my face and my knee. I want to fight six more years, until my 40s.”
Wanderlei Silva has admitted he would be keen on a fight with Chris Leben when he returns to action.
“He won’t pass the first two rounds with me,” Silva said. “I saw his fight with Akiyama. It was a great match, and he beat him in the final round. He’s a tough guy. He had only fought two weeks earlier. I think it will be perfect for my next fight.
“If he wants me, I’m going to fight him for sure.”
